Automatic Fiber Optic Cable Laying System

Automatic fiber optic cable laying systems enable precise, efficient, and safe deployment of fiber networks using advanced machinery and automation technologies.

Overview

Automatic fiber optic cable laying systems are designed to streamline the installation of fiber optic networks, reducing manual labor, improving accuracy, and minimizing environmental disruption. These systems are used in onshore, offshore, and urban environments, and can handle a wide range of cable types, from standard fiber to high-capacity transoceanic cables .

Key Components and Technologies

  • Cable Lay Equipment: Systems include cable drums, winches, capstan drives, and transport trailers that ensure smooth cable deployment and tension control . Advanced systems use pitch-compensated load cells for accurate load measurement and tension management .
  • Automation and Integration: Modern systems can interface with vessel dynamic positioning (DP) systems or vehicle control systems for fully automated cable laying operations. Real-time data feedback allows operators to monitor tension, speed, and position, reducing the risk of cable damage .
  • Ploughs and Microtrenching Machines: For underground or urban installations, specialized ploughs and microtrenching machines like Tesmec's CLEAN & FAST or CityCleanFast systems allow precise trenching and simultaneous cable placement with minimal disruption .
  • Blow-in and Mini Cable Systems: For smaller fiber networks, blow-in systems and mini cable installation machines enable rapid deployment in ducts or conduits, suitable for FTTH (Fiber to the Home) projects .

Applications

  • Offshore and Subsea: Fully integrated cable lay vessels deploy long-distance submarine fiber optic cables with automated tension control and ploughing for seabed installation .
  • Urban and Roadside Networks: Microtrenching and vacuum-assisted trenching systems allow fiber deployment in narrow streets, sidewalks, and medians with reduced excavation and environmental impact .
  • Large-Scale Infrastructure: Automated winches, cable drum lifters, and synchronized back-deck handling systems support high-volume cable installation for telecom, power, and broadband networks .

Advantages

  • Efficiency: Automation reduces installation time and labor costs while maintaining consistent cable tension and alignment .
  • Safety: Minimizes manual handling and exposure to hazardous conditions, particularly in offshore or urban construction sites .
  • Flexibility: Systems can be adapted to different vessel types, vehicles, or project scales, from small urban networks to transoceanic cables .
  • Environmental Impact: Microtrenching and precise ploughing reduce excavation volume, soil disruption, and traffic interference .

Conclusion

Automatic fiber optic cable laying systems combine mechanical precision, automation, and real-time monitoring to optimize fiber network deployment. Whether for subsea, urban, or large-scale infrastructure projects, these systems enhance speed, safety, and reliability while reducing operational costs and environmental impact .
